EOP First-Year Summer Academy

The EOP First-Year Summer Academy is designed to provide students with a holistic orientation to collegiate life at SUNY Old Westbury.

Courses are taught by SUNY Old Westbury faculty along with professional counselors and peer/tutor mentors who implement an educational curriculum designed to enhance and strengthen the academic and social orientation for pre-first year students.  EOP Staff provides individual and group counseling, along with Student Success workshops, to help participants develop characteristics and social, emotional learning as they acclimate to collegiate life.

Summer Academy students will also participate in the campus' Summer Orientation Program that takes place during the 4-week program. EOP students will be participating in of all the activities during the Orientation Program.

EOP SUMMER Academy FAQ
  • Why do we host the EOP Summer Academy?
    • Educational research has found that students who attend a comprehensive Pre-college Summer Program are more likely to graduate from school and get a job in their desired field.  This is what we want for all of our EOP students.  We require students to participate in our Pre-Summer College Academy, because it works! As a result of EOP, you will be among the most prepared students on campus when the fall semester begins.
  • Is participation in the EOP Summer Academy mandatory?
    • All incoming first-year EOP students must fully participate in the 4-week EOP Summer Academy before beginning their first semester.
  • What does the Summer Academy cost?
    • The cost of the EOP Summer Academy, including housing, meals, tuition and activities is completely covered by EOP and SUNY Old Westbury

  • Can I have visitors?
    • Students are expected to fully immerse themselves in the EOP Summer Academy to prepare for the first semester. Because of the intensive nature of the program we do not allow visitors, unless there is an emergency or extenuating circumstance.  In cases of emergency, visitors are asked to check in with the EOP Office, located in K-110 or University Police.
